-
@H_403_16@
@H_403_16@
自动地构建、测试软件项目。本文介绍在 windows 平台上安装 Jenkins master 和 slave。
,直接运行,一路 "next" 就可以了。安装包执行完成后会启动你机器上默认的浏览器进行初始化配置和基本插件的安装。
文件中的密码输入到 UI 中,按照 UI 中的说明填入密码,然后继续。
插件进行安装:
插件,点击第一个大大的按钮继续。接下来是安装这些插件,这个过程完全是在线安装,一般情况下会比较慢。
插件安装完成后进入第三步:
管理员账号,点击 "Save and Finish"。下个界面会提示 Jenkins 已经完成安装,点击 "Start using Jenkins" 进入 Jenkins 的主界面:
Manage Jenkins->Configure Global Security):
随机就可以了。
添加 slave 配置
Manage Jenkins->Manage Nodes):
Name:该节点的名字。
Description:说明这个节点的用途。
# of executors:允许在这个节点上并发执行任务的数量,一般设置为 cpu 支持的线程数。
Remote root directory:节点上 Jenkins 的根目录。
Labels:分配给这个节点的标签。
Usage:节点的使用策略。
Launch method:启动 agent 的方式,对于 windows 平台,最好选择 "Launch agent via Java Web Start"。
Availability:Jenkins 控制 slave 是否在线的策略。
登录前面创建的 Jenkins,并打开刚才创建的节点:
提示下把一个叫 slave-agent.jnlp 的文件保存到本地。管理员的权限启动命令行, 执行 slave-agent.jnlp 文件,最终会启动一个小程序:
自动连接 master。在上面的 File 菜单中点击 "Install as a service",完成安装后上面的小程序会自动关闭,一个 Windows Service 被创建:
页面: